How to drain the washer dryer

Could anybody please tell me how to set the machine to "drain only"? (ie what number on the dial should I turn it to?). The machine has an inch or so of water sat in the bottom! Thanks.

Try the rinse cycle. Rinse typically operates the pump to drain water from the barrel.

Washer wont drain showin IE

Sonia, you either have a failed drain pump, or something has bypassed the filter ( bobby pins are notorious for this ) and is jamming up the pump impeller. If you can set the washer to drain/spin and can hear the pump running, you most likely have a impeller that has broken off of the pump motor shaft and will need to be replaced. If you cannot hear the pump running, and can hear a slight humming noise, then there is something jammed in the pump. The pump can be removed and cleared of the possible foriegn object. Kenmore 4314220

It sounds like you could have a couple of issues going on here. First of all, to answer the question about stacking the units; there is a mounting kit that you are supposed to use to place the dryer on top of the washer. The top is supposed to come off the washer to accomplish this. There are a couple of brackets to install and the dryer is supposed to mount to the washer with a couple of screws. Your local appliance store should be able to provide this for you. All you need is the model number of the washer and dryer. If the timer is only working on one cycle then you may have a bad timer. But...before we go jumping on that bandwagon...you mentioned that the washer is not filling and the water just keeps running out. This sounds like a problem known as "siphoning". If you have placed your drain hose in the standpipe in a manner that does not provide an air gap for drainage, the washer will not fill and will continue to "siphon" water from the machine as it tries to fill. If the washer cannot fill, the pressure switch will not shut off, and the timer will not advance any further. Double check your drain line to make sure you do not have it shoved too far down in the standpipe (3" to 4" should be sufficient). If the drain hose is sitting in the drain trap where the water sits, there's no air gap. Also, make sure you do not have the top of the standpipe sealed for any reason. Once again, you need an air gap in order for the water to drain properly. Let me know if this helps you.
